Bringing Couples Closer During Pregnancy and Birth
Pregnancy and birth are such monumental events in a couple's life. It can be a time of immense joy, anticipation, and a bit of anxiety too, right? It's also a time of big changes and adjustments as you prepare to welcome a new little person into your world. While it's natural to want to share these experiences with your loved ones, involving your husband from the very beginning can truly strengthen your bond as a couple. Think of it as building a strong foundation for your growing family.
The sources highlight how vital a strong marital foundation is during this time. Think about it - you and your husband are a team, and this incredible journey is something you're embarking on together. When you actively include him in all aspects, it fosters a sense of unity and shared responsibility. This shared responsibility isn’t just about practical tasks; it’s about the emotional connection too! From doctor's appointments to feeling those first little kicks, by experiencing these moments together, you're creating a deeper connection that will serve you well as new parents.
Now, I know having your mom, sister, or best friend by your side during labor sounds tempting. They've been your rock, your confidante, and you might even feel a bit shy about certain aspects of labor with your husband present. But consider this: allowing your husband to be your primary support person during labor and delivery can be profoundly bonding. It allows him to witness the incredible strength and love you possess, and it gives him the opportunity to step up and be your advocate and protector during this vulnerable time. This is a great step towards a healthy, strong marital boundary. When you put your husband first in those instances rather that a family member or friend you as showing him and everyone that this is your family unit, just you him and soon your baby. Not you two and your parents or his parents or your best friend. Just you and him. And that is so important especially in helping him feel connected to you and your baby when he might feel a little helpless in this incredible beautiful process.
Remember, your family and friends will always have a special place in your lives, and they can certainly be involved in other ways throughout your pregnancy and after the baby arrives. But when it comes to those intimate moments, prioritizing your husband's involvement can truly make all the difference in bringing you closer together. Especially since it is so common for husbands to feel disconnected from their wife when a baby comes along because it’s not something they are experiencing like the mother is with her own body. Then once the baby is born her natural instinct is to devote everything to that tiny baby and might not be very focused on him, but if she involves him in all of those hospital appointments, baby kicks, the birth, and the care of that baby it will make your relationship together so much more intimate and strong.
It's about forging an unbreakable bond, experiencing those special moments as a united front, and starting your parenting journey on the same page. By creating these unique, shared experiences, you're setting the stage for a stronger and more fulfilling family life.
